Everyone is familiar with the 4.0 redesign of Protoss, most notably the removal of the Mothership Core. Of course, there were many other changes (Shield Battery, Recall, Stalker buff, etc) but the largest aspect of 4.0 for Protoss was the MSC being removed, and the subsequent redesign of Protoss around its absence. And I think I speak for most people when I say that, on the whole, the state of Protoss post-4.0 has been far and away superior to Protoss pre-4.0. Obviously there were some balance issues that needed to be worked out, but at this point I think it’s safe to say that removing the MSC was a resoundingly successful redesign.

Recently, there has been some design-related attention towards Zerg (specifically from uthermal), most of which can be distilled down to the Queen and its many, many roles. Creep-spreading, hatch-injecting, early-defense anti-air with transfusions, you name it and the Queen does it. They’re massed in the early game for defending harass. They’re massed in the lategame for transfuse. They’re massed because they’re quite frankly great units and too many Queens is a rare problem indeed.

The flip side to this is of course that Queens are absolutely essential to keeping Zerg in the game. Without good creep spread, defending is impossible. Without injections, there are no larvae. Without beefy tanks, hellions and adepts run wild. Without AA, drops pull the Zerg apart. Without transfusions, critical units die in seconds. Without Queens, Zerg is quite simply hopeless.

So. Can’t live with them, can’t live without them. What’s to do?

At this juncture, it’s very important to note that Queens are NOT a balance problem. Much like Protoss can and was balanced quite well around the MSC, Zerg can and is balanced quite well around the Queen. That being said, simply because something is not a balance problem does not mean it cannot be improved design-wise.

With 4.0, the current balance team has shown that it is capable of redesigning major aspects of the Protoss race in a competent fashion. What say you about letting them try with Zerg?

I've always found inject larva to be a profoundly unfun part of Zerg, and I never entirely got over how much more fun the game was to play during that LotV beta patch when transfuse was automated.

The problem is that it's a necessary APM handicap on Zerg players, due to their simplified (otherwise) macro. I would absolutely love for Queens to be redesigned and for injection to be removed. However, it must sadly be admitted that something else would need to rise in order to take injection's place, unless major changes were made elsewhere to Zerg.

Redesigning the queen is probably a harder task than redesigning the mothership core though. The MC's role was essentially to allow Protoss to survive early on with some utility in the midgame. The queen does all that (and is one of the only forms of defensive advantage in early ZvZ), and so much more.

Some QoL "improvement" (like the high templars) along with emphasis on base mobile defense instead of very long range.

Do you hate when your queen is not close enough to the hatchery and can't inject? Or kited by that carrier that is flying away? I present the Queen-ken.
Increase the larva inject range to 3, and reduce anti air attack range to 7 reduce transfusion cast range to 5. Queens health is reduced to 125. Increase off-creep movement speed to 2.63 (This is the same speed as upgraded Overlord, faster than Brood lord and can kite Carriers off creep.) Increase on-creep speed to 3.9375. (This is the same speed as Hydralisk.).
Queen will now gain a new passive ability:
Symbiosis:
Queen will received increased regeneration speed to 1.4 Hit Point per second while in 3 range of a hatchery.

What if I need to keep queens in place? Queen will now gain a new ability:
Make Nest:
Grants the Queen 25% wider vision, and increase its ground attack range to 6 and anti-air attack range to 8, but removes its ability to move. This ability is instant cast but have a 1 second cool down. The nest will spread creep for a range of 6 until the queen is killed or stop making nest. This ability can be canceled after activation. This ability can be cast while burrowed.

Enjoy send your queens to middle of nowhere. (Or proxy hatch and make a queen next to it.)

Thats funny..I might be bias, but i think queens are one of the best designed unit in the game. They have a clear defensive role, and while massing them will make you stronger defensively and give you a better set up for the long macro game ( creep spread, injects, etc). By massing queens, the zerg becomes stronger defensively but weaker offensively. Also, they have some good decision making involved on how you spend the energy, and they reward faster and more skilled players by allowing faster and better creep spread and transfuses.

As far as i know, there isnt any unit in the game that is made unviable because of the existence of the queen.
Meanwhile, you have units like thors and pheonix that completely invalidates mutalisks, no amount of micro can save that.

Mutalisks are a badly designed unit currently in my opinion. Its the regeneration that is too strong, and it makes super hard counters like thors and shoot while moving phoenixes; with range upgrade even, almost mandatory.

I feel like mutalisks should lose a lot of their regen, but gain 1 extra armor possibly or a bit more life to compensate. After that, you could actually nerf thors and pheonixes, so the interactions between those units are less 1 sided.

I mean i guess Queens could use a small combat nerf, but it would require, like said above, a swap of the hydra and roaches accessiblity and stats/price. I would love a 1 supply cheaper and weaker hydra. And a 2 supply stronger but more expensive roach.

It's a tough call. I might be in the minority but I tend to think the queen is a bit too strong balance-wise, but actually makes a lot of sense design wise.

Zerg can just die to so many things and the queen adds a stability to the race that I think is really important. Yes, early game defence is way too centralised on the queen, but I think that is balanced somewhat by the fact that queens have very little offensive potential. I imagine any design change to zerg would very likely have too strong offensive/cheese potential, coupled with the larva mechanic would make things really bad IMO.

The lack of offensive anti-air in the early game for Zerg IMO is actually super important to allow any sort of macro game in ZvP. Almost every other build in PvZ has fallen out of favour because it's so hard to consistently take a third base against Zerg without a SG. People talk about stuff like tier 1 hydras etc, I think it's a dumb idea that would take so many other changes to have it work at all; larva is just too strong in sc2 for zerg to have actual well rounded units in early game.

I don't actually mind the queen dynamic in ZvT, and again I think it's important that it fixes a lot of defensive holes for Zerg without being able to be used offensive (except for Nydus/Proxy, and I do think Nydus should be looked at a bit for this reason). I just feel like it's too good, Zerg masses queens to stay alive but even if the Terran never attacks, they aren't behind. It seems like making a lot of queens is ideal in every scenario (mass queens does allow Terran to get into the late game to some extent, but Terran late-game isn't good enough for this to be an actual good tradeoff).

I'd prefer things more in line with:
Limit maximum energy on Queens so they don't store many transfuses as the game goes on
General nerfs to the strength of the Queen
Terran late game buffs (I think this is really important because the reason queens are so good rn is that terrans want to end the game as early as possible and queens become so useful and relevant against this style)

If someone comes up with some genius design change, I'd be happy to change my mind but it seems like a really difficult thing to do. I'd personally just be really happy to see what Queens would be like if their energy capacity was severely limited.
